Overview Of The Subway Menu And New 2026 Updates

Subway’s 2026 menu refresh brings in updated sandwich choices and more visible pricing cues. The Subway Fresh Value Menu will be available in most U.S. markets. Certain locations will also test limited-time breads and signature sandwiches with bold flavors. Local availability is not identical everywhere, so check local listings before ordering.
What’s New On The 2026 Menu
Subway introduced the Subway Series with twelve new sandwiches and signature sauces. The Fresh Value Menu features 15 entrees under $5, including Deli Faves and Protein Pockets at $3.99. In select markets like New York, diners can find occasional limited breads, such as the ghost pepper return. Major city markets will also offer expanded all-day breakfast.
How Pricing Varies By Location
Current Subway menu prices vary widely by region. 6″ sandwiches cost between $5 and $8 in most areas, while footlongs range from $8 to $12. Costs often climb in California, Washington, Alaska, and Hawaii. Final totals may include extra charges for tax, delivery, and third-party fees. Check the Subway app to check current local offers and participating locations.

2026 Subway Menu With Prices
The following is a quick breakdown of recent Subway menu prices and representative items. This allows readers to see typical costs and choices for 2026. Prices vary by region and participating restaurants, with more expensive examples in states like California, Washington, Alaska, and Hawaii. These examples combine New York City figures and national value-menu listings to give a more grounded view of subway menu prices across formats.
Example Price Ranges For Popular Subs
Typical sandwich price examples draws from New York City highlights and broader lists. A Steak & Cheese 6″ often runs near $10.79 with a footlong about $16.19. The Spicy Nacho Chicken in footlong size can hit roughly $15.39. Signature premium options like The Beast footlong may cost around $17.89. Older favorites can show broader price bands: Meatball 6″ from $5.49 to $8.69 and footlong examples near $12.89 in some menus.
| Sub | 6″ Price (Approx.) | Footlong Price (Approx.) | Calorie Range (Approx.)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Steak & Cheese | About $10.79 | $16.19 | About 650–1,300 |
| Spicy Nacho Chicken | $8.99 | Approx. $15.39 | About 700–1,400 |
| Beast Sandwich | $11.19 | Approx. $17.89 | 900–1,600 |
| Classic Meatball Marinara | About $5.49–$8.69 | About $8.79–$12.89 | 700–1,200 |
Breakfast, Wraps, Salads, And Bowls Pricing
The breakfast section at Subway features familiar morning items with mid-range pricing. A Bacon, Egg & Cheese sandwich is about $8.39. Wrap choices often run higher: a Steak, Egg & Cheese wrap example is roughly $13.79.
Breadless menu choices often carry near-footlong pricing for premium fillings. The Philly bowl often shows at about $16.19. The sweet onion chicken teriyaki bowl option shows near $15.39. Salad choices like Chicken & Bacon Ranch or a Philly salad are commonly about $13.19. For customers wondering how much is a footlong at Subway across different items, expect $10–$18 depending on the recipe and market.
| Item Type | Expected Price | Quick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Breakfast Sandwiches | Approx. $5.49–$8.39 | Egg-based items, regional availability |
| Wrapped Options | About $8.99–$13.79 | Review wrap pricing because fillings and locations affect cost |
| Breadless Bowls | About $12.99–$16.19 | Breadless options priced near footlongs |
| Salads | Approx. $9.99–$13.19 | Salads combine proteins, vegetables, and regional ingredient availability |
Cookies, Sides, Drinks, Bundles, And Catering
Combo offers and side items remain central to value. Common combo deals (sub + chips + drink) land around $8–$10 at many locations. The Fresh Value Menu highlights Deli Faves 6″ at $3.99, Protein Pockets at $3.99, and Sub of the Day 6″ for $4.99 on rotation.
Cookie costs show a wide spectrum. The 6-pack cookie option can be about $4.49 while a single footlong cookie lists near $5.00–$5.99. For reference on the single item price, the subway footlong cookie price often appears around those numbers depending on store.
| Menu Item | Approx. Price | Details |
|---|---|---|
| Sub Combo With Chips And Drink | Approx. $8–$10 | Store participation varies; value-menu upgrades may add roughly $2 |
| Cookie 6-Pack | Approx. $4.49 | Useful party or snack option |
| Footlong Dessert Cookie | $5.00–$5.99 | Big treat option with store-by-store price variation |
| Bottled Beverages | Approx. $2.99–$3.49 | Fountain prices vary by restaurant |
| Subway Catering Platters | $60–$75 | Catering trays for meetings, parties, and larger orders |

Bread Choices, Toppings, Sauces And Subway Customization Options
Subway lets customers to build your perfect sandwich. Begin by selecting from a variety of subway menu bread choices. After that, choose your favorite veggies, proteins, and sauces. The Subway website and app provide a list of available bread options at your local Subway.
Popular Subway Bread Options
- Italian — a classic foundation for many sandwiches and a frequent pick among fans who prefer a soft crumb.
- Hearty Multigrain — a thicker seeded loaf that adds texture and fiber.
- Wheat — a mild whole-wheat bread often matched with turkey, veggie, and leaner sandwiches.
- Flatbread / Lavash — a thinner wrap form found in many stores, popular for breakfast and lighter builds.
- Garlic & Herb — a flavored option available in select markets, often used for limited-time sandwiches.
Subway Bread Names And Local Varieties
Some NYC and regional locations offer specialty items like lavash or occasional limited breads. The subway bread options list can change from one restaurant to another because not every restaurant stocks every loaf.
Subway Menu Toppings And List Of Subway Toppings
- Lettuce, Roma tomatoes, cucumbers, red onions, green peppers
- Olives, pickled toppings, spinach, jalapeños, and banana peppers
- Avocado — offered as an extra topping at many restaurants
Common Subway Sauces And Condiments In The USA
The chain offers classic and signature sauces. Typical sauces include mayo, honey mustard, garlic aioli, chipotle, creamy Sriracha, sweet onion sauce, and Peppercorn Ranch. To see a complete Subway sauces list USA guide, check the app or in-store menu where regional sauces may appear.
Dietary Options And Gluten-Free Notes
Is gluten-free bread available at Subway? Certain participating locations have carried gluten-free bread on a trial basis. Many customers select No Bready Bowls or salads as an alternative to avoid gluten. Watch for cross-contact risks when ordering subway gluten free bread and confirm local availability before assuming it’s an option.

Subway Deals, Rewards, And Savings Tips For 2026
Scoring the best deal at Subway requires a combination of planning, rewards, and flexible choices. Always check for promotions before placing your order. This ensures you snag discounts and avoid unexpected delivery fees. Keep in mind, prices can vary by state, so include that in your budget.
Fresh Value Menu offers can be useful for everyday savings. The value menu includes around 15 entrees under $5, with Deli Faves and Protein Pockets often priced at $3.99. Subway’s rotating Sub of the Day offers a $6.99 six-inch sandwich, helping to reduce your meal cost. Including chips and a beverage can convert a budget item into a more satisfying meal for a small extra charge.
MVP Rewards from Subway makes it easier to earn and redeem points. Create an account, link your purchases through the Subway app, and start collecting points. These points can be exchanged for Subway Cash on future orders. The Subway app also offers exclusive promotions and digital coupons, adding to your savings.
To cut costs even more, combine coupons with strategic ordering. Look for subway coupons 2026 before large orders and pair them with in-app deals when possible. Choose Fresh Value Menu items or share a footlong to split the cost. For small extras, choose bundled chips and drinks instead of separate items.
Ordering for groups or events can also save money. Boxed lunches and catering platters often bring down the cost per sandwich.
